#include <QByteArray>
namespace Lisp
{
struct RowCol
{
enum { ROW_BIT_LEN = 19, COL_BIT_LEN = 32 - ROW_BIT_LEN - 1 };
uint row : ROW_BIT_LEN; // supports 524k lines
uint col : COL_BIT_LEN; // supports 4k chars per line
uint unused : 1; // the sign is used to recognize the packed representation
RowCol():row(0),col(0),unused(0) {}
RowCol( quint32 row, quint32 col );
bool setRowCol( quint32 row, quint32 col );
bool isValid() const { return row > 0 && col > 0; } // valid lines and cols start with 1; 0 is invalid
bool operator==( const RowCol& rhs ) const { return row == rhs.row && col == rhs.col; }
quint32 packed() const { return ( row << COL_BIT_LEN ) | col; }
static bool isPacked( quint32 rowCol ) { return rowCol; }
static quint32 unpackCol(quint32 rowCol ) { return rowCol & ( ( 1 << COL_BIT_LEN ) -1 ); }
static quint32 unpackRow(quint32 rowCol ) { return ( ( rowCol ) >> COL_BIT_LEN ); }
};
}
#endif // LISPROWCOL_H
